Is 15 fps good for security cameras?

A good frame rate for security cameras is around 15 to 30 FPS. Video footage recorded at 30 FPS is ideal for identifying intruders or threats. The industry standard hovers around 15 FPS as of 2019.

What does 15 fps means?

At 15fps, input will take upto 1/15th of a second to be shown in game, so in a fps for example, your gun could fire almost a tenth of a second late.

What is average FPS?

24fps –This is the standard for movies and TV shows, and it was determined to be the minimum speed needed to capture video while still maintaining realistic motion. Even if a film is shot at a higher frame rate, it's often produced and displayed at 24fps. Most feature films and TV shows are shot and viewed at 24 fps.

Does higher FPS reduce lag?

Displaying more frames per second reduces the delay between inputting a command and seeing its result on the screen, shaving valuable milliseconds off input lag.

Does high FPS matter?

Higher frames per second, also known as frame rates, make the image appear smoother and more realistic. Subjectively, there's a huge jump between 15fps and 30fps. There's less of a noticeable jump between 30 and 60, and even less between 60 and 120.

How many FPS is fast?

Any frame rate at 60fps or above is considered a high-speed frame rate. For example, 60fps, 120fps, and 240fps would all be considered high speed and are typically used for slow-motion video. Some cameras can even go as fast as 1,000 frames per second.
